Transaction fc88f51decda346f1423134c17ae9205161a84ab121be23b60059a2808d27c41
1 Input
1 Output
-
fc88f51decda346f1423134c17ae9205161a84ab121be23b60059a2808d27c41:0
- value
- 1332156
- script pubkey
- OP_0 OP_PUSHBYTES_20 6635ecfbbd28bf32a56cbc55df2338fb81348ba6
- address
- bc1qvc67e7aa9zln9ftvh32a7geclwqnfzaxpuqxyj